Sheet Pan Smoky BBQ Chicken and Roasted Sweet Potatoes

Enjoy a balanced and flavorful sheet pan dinner featuring smoky BBQ chicken paired with perfectly roasted sweet potatoes. The dish boasts tender, juicy chicken enhanced with a smoky BBQ glaze, complemented by the natural sweetness of roasted sweet potatoes, all finished with a hint of olive oil and aromatic spices.

INGREDIENTS

6 ounces Chicken Breast

1 medium Sweet Potato

1/2 tablespoon Olive Oil

2 tablespoons Smoky BBQ Sauce

1 teaspoon Paprika

1 teaspoon Garlic Powder

Salt and Pepper to taste

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at the oven to 425°F and line a sheet pan with parchment paper.

  • 2

    Cut the sweet potato into 1/2-inch cubes for even roasting.

  • 3

    Place the chicken breast and sweet potato cubes on the sheet pan.

  • 4

    Drizzle olive oil over the sweet potatoes and season with salt, pepper, paprika, and garlic powder. Toss gently to coat evenly.

  • 5

    Brush the chicken breasts with smoky BBQ sauce on both sides, and season lightly with salt and pepper.

  • 6

    Arrange the chicken and sweet potatoes on the pan ensuring they are evenly spaced.

  • 7

    Roast in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until the chicken reaches an internal temperature of 165°F and the sweet potatoes are tender and lightly caramelized.

  • 8

    Remove from oven, let rest for a few minutes, then serve warm.
